Transaction 78b6e28d320c4ca0e603ec7c2e29b61f6f81a304e1426f057b660dba9c7586ff

10 Input
2 Outputs
  • 78b6e28d320c4ca0e603ec7c2e29b61f6f81a304e1426f057b660dba9c7586ff:0
  • value  29563568
    address  39ZDMgt7w6PZXDHn2FjQ7nj5mnKDRhRy1x
  • 78b6e28d320c4ca0e603ec7c2e29b61f6f81a304e1426f057b660dba9c7586ff:1
  • value  80628796
    address  3LUo5oktXxcKF1CHyoCrNTdEtdDLj2548f